Love's New Beginnings

por Diana Stout

While in Europe on a piano concert tour, Charlene Walker's grandfather dies. Returning to New York late at night with the intent to attend the funeral, she is mugged, receiving a concussion and a severely broken arm, which puts her career on hold and missing the funeral. While she's in the hospital, her boyfriend manager runs off with her entire savings. Her life is in shambles. Finally able to travel to Willow Junction, Michigan, she attends the reading of her grandfather's Will. She learns she's inherited half of an apple orchard and must live in his house for six months in order to inherit, plus deal with a business partner who appears to dislike her. What did her grandfather tell him? When Logan Taylor's wife deserted him and their infant son four years ago, Logan swore off women and hasn't dated since. The last thing he wants is a partner, especially a woman. He had been planning on was purchasing the business from Charlie Walker, his long-term employer, who died unexpectedly before arrangements could be finalized. Once settled into her grandfather's house, Charlene learns everything isn't as it appears. Plus, she finds herself trusting Logan too easily without understanding why. Could it be love, for the first time in her life? From the beginning, they both know her being in Willow Junction will be a short-term affair.
